footer,.site-footer,footer[role=contentinfo]{font-size:.9375rem;line-height:1.5}footer p,.site-footer p,footer li,.site-footer li,footer a,.site-footer a{font-size:inherit}.button-group{display:none}.button-group.button-group-horizontal{text-align:center;margin:0;font-size:1rem;justify-content:center;flex-wrap:wrap;gap:5px;position:fixed;bottom:0;left:0;right:0;background-color:#fff;padding:15px;box-shadow:0 -2px 8px #0000001a;z-index:999}.button-group.button-group-horizontal.at-bottom{position:static;box-shadow:0 -2px 8px #0000001a}.button-group .button-item{display:inline-flex;align-items:center;gap:8px;background-color:#009b42;color:#fff;padding:12px 20px;text-decoration:none;border-radius:4px;transition:background-color .3s ease}.button-group .button-item:hover{background-color:#007a32}@media(max-width:768px){.button-group{display:flex}}
